Subject: Question about i.Mx27 + wm8974: lots of noise
Date: Fri, 03 Sep 2010 00:41:28 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1283445688.30946.20.camel@UT43> (raw)

Hi all,

I have been developing alsa driver for wm8974 + i.MX27.By now, the
playback channel works well. But there is lots of noise in my record
file. The input audio is from aux input. I have configured wm8974 so
that ONLY the aux input goes into ADC. (The INPPGAMUTE bit is 1  and the
MICP2BOOSTVOL is 0.) And I have enabled the Speaker Line Bypass switch
so that I can verify that the aux input is correct and the bypass output
is very clear. That means that there is nothing wrong with the ADC
input. But the wav file (generated by command "arecord -d 20 -c 1 -f
S16_LE -r 8000 -t wav foobar.wav") contains both the aux input audio and
lots of noise, which makes the quality of the record file even
unacceptable. 

Since the playback works well, the register setting of wm8974 and mx27
ssi seems to be correct. 

What's the possible reason causing so much noise? Can the digital filers
of ADC be helpful to eliminate recording noise and improve the quality
of record file?
